Yeah, MG. The new model SC250 has an adjustable stoptail as standard equipment. Basically, PRS discontinued the High Gloss Singlecut model this year. In it's place are two variations. The 245, which has a 24.5" scale length and the 250, which has the standard 25" scale length. Then there are the SC250 Satin, Singlecut Standard Satin and then the Trem variations.

The SC250 has really hot pickups, an adjustable bridge and locking tuners. The SC245 is more vintage in every way. Shorter scale length, more vintagy pickups and Kluson style tuners.
